Odisha-Meghalaya MoU to Boost Early Childhood Care and Development
Odisha and Meghalaya have taken a collaborative step to improve outcomes for young children by signing a new agreement on early childhood development. The partnership focuses on sharing experiences, building capacities, and strengthening services related to health, nutrition, and early learning, recognizing that the early years are critical for lifelong well being.
The governments of Odisha and Meghalaya have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to strengthen Early Childhood Care, Education and Development (ECCED) through inter-state cooperation and mutual learning.
The MoU aims to create a structured framework for collaboration in early childhood development.
By combining strengths from both states, the partnership seeks to improve the quality and reach of early childhood services in diverse social and geographic contexts.
